    Unveiling the Rich Tapestry of Bourbon: Exploring Bardstown, Kentucky

    Bardstown, Kentucky, often referred to as the “Bourbon Capital of the World,” is a haven for bourbon enthusiasts and connoisseurs. The region’s rolling hills, historic distilleries, and deep-rooted bourbon culture have earned it a distinguished place in the hearts of whiskey lovers. In this blog post, we’ll take a deep dive into the bourbon industry in Bardstown, exploring its history, significant distilleries, and the art of crafting this iconic American spirit. A Historical Glimpse Bardstown’s connection to bourbon traces back to the late 18th century when settlers, primarily of Irish and Scottish descent, began distilling corn-based spirits.     20 Fascinating Facts About Bardstown Kentucky

      Bourbon Capital: Bardstown is often referred to as the “Bourbon Capital of the World” due to its rich history and association with bourbon production. Oldest Bourbon Distillery: The Barton 1792 Distillery in Bardstown is one of the oldest fully operating distilleries in the state, dating back to 1879. Talbott Tavern: This historic tavern is over 200 years old and has hosted notable figures like Abraham Lincoln and Jesse James. Bourbon Festival: Bardstown hosts an annual Kentucky Bourbon Festival, celebrating the region’s renowned bourbon heritage.
